John Hill Aughey. Repression of dissent in the pre-Civil War South is an issue that is rarely discussed. Tupelo is a brilliant first person, totally truthful account, of a man imprisoned and condemned to execution by the arrogant officials of the South for his outspoken anti-Secession and pro-Union beliefs.
He twice made his escape, and the second time, through almost incredible exposures and perils, succeeded in reaching the lines of the Union army.
